Hypothetical Propositions
Statements or propositions that are based on assumptions or hypothesis rather than on concrete evidence.
Formal Operations
A stage in Jean Piaget's theory of cognitive development where individuals gain the ability to think abstractly, logically, and systematically, typically beginning in adolescence.
Ability
The possession of the means or skill to do something or perform a task effectively.
Private Speech
Vocal communication that individuals direct to themselves, often used as a tool for thought processing and problem-solving, particularly in children.
